Form D of Ancula gibbosa sensu lato with opaque white spots, and white or yellowish white pigment on appendages. From an abundant local population on a muddy substrate in Vancouver Harbour on the Pacific coast of Canada, February, 2007. Amphipod resting on gills. © N. McDaniel.
A similar form also occurs on the Pacific coast of Russia. Their statuses are uncertain as, currently, there are no publicly available molecular sequences of spotted A. gibbosa from the eastern or western Pacific.
